What does a Fortnite Game Designer do?

As a Fortnite Game Designer, your day often involves collaborating with artists, developers, and product managers to brainstorm and prototype new features or content. You'll review player feedback, balance gameplay elements, and participate in playtests to ensure new updates are engaging and fair. Regular meetings focus on aligning the team's vision and tracking progress on upcoming releases. The environment is fast-paced and creative, with frequent opportunities to contribute ideas and see your work directly impact millions of players.

What You'll Be Doing

As a Fortnite Coach, your role will be dynamic and rewarding. You’ll guide young players in developing their skills while encouraging good sportsmanship and healthy gaming habits. Here’s what your responsibilities will look like:

  • Skill Development: Lead weekly practice sessions focused on core Fortnite mechanics like building, editing, aiming, and movement.
  • Strategic Coaching: Teach players advanced strategies, including drop spots, rotations, storm awareness, and late-game decision-making.
  • VOD Reviews: Analyze gameplay footage with students to identify mistakes and highlight areas for improvement.
  • Team Dynamics: (If applicable) Coach Duo or Squad teams on communication, synergizing loadouts, and playing as a cohesive unit.
  • Character Building: Promote tilt management, healthy gaming habits, and good sportsmanship both in and out of the game.
  • Parental Communication: Keep parents informed with regular updates on their child’s progress, behavior, and upcoming academy events.
What We're Looking For

We’re searching for a coach who not only knows Fortnite inside and out but also has the skills to connect with young players and their families. To be successful in this role, you’ll need:

  • Game Proficiency: High-level competitive experience in Fortnite (e.g., currently or recently ranked in Champion or Unreal).
  • Coaching/Teaching Experience: Prior experience working with youth (camps, tutoring, traditional sports coaching, etc.) is highly preferred.
  • Communication Skills: The ability to break down complex gaming concepts into simple, engaging lessons for younger players.
  • Reliability: Punctuality and the ability to manage a consistent weekly schedule are a must.
  • Safety: You must pass a comprehensive background check, as this role involves working closely with youth.
